On February 1, 2010, the balance of the retained earnings account of Blue Power Corporation was $567,000. Revenues for February totaled $110,700, of which $103,500 was collected in cash. Expenses for February totaled $65,500, of which $54,000 was paid in cash. Dividends declared and paid during February were $6,000.

Calculate the retained earnings balance at February 28, 2010.
